While Garmin taking the time to develop the GPS phone, Mio announced their GPS phone product at CES. The Mio’s GPS phone is a dual sided cell phone and personal navigation system. At the phone side it has a shiny, silver cover, and at the GPS side it has a large touch screen similar to iPhone.
